Why are Paul Allen and Steve Wozniak given so little credit?

Why do we hear so much about Bill Gates and Steve Jobs, while Paul Allen and Steve Wozniak appear to be forgotten? Gates and Jobs were the Captains of the team when their team rose to the top. Their personal image became part of the brand, as much as the product they represented.

Famous business leaders often become media personalities, Elon Musk comes to mind in current events. How many people realize that Elon Musk did not create Tesla motors? Elon Musk bought into Tesla Motors after it was created. Do many people know the names Martin Eberhard and Marc Tarpenning, the original founders of Tesla Motors?

I see it all the time as I study the great inventors, another name that comes to mind is Thomas Edison, a great innovator and inventor often criticized for being more of a businessman than an inventor. My comeback is usually to ask why people think that being a successful businessman is mutually exclusive of being a successful innovator and inventor.

Edison was not the only great idea man of his generation, just the one most remembered. Some people love Edison as the great inventor, others despise him as a ruthless businessman.

Same thing with Bill Gates and Steve Jobs, some people admire them, some people hate them. Their very outgoing personalities, that some would call aggressive, helped them to lead their companies, it helped them to succeed, and it made them news worthy as well.

Most people don't seen to care about history and only remember what they were told in 30 second sound bites. That's really a shame, the history of companies like Microsoft and Apple are fascinating. We can learn a lot from the stories of Paul Allen and Steve Wozniak.

Thankfully we live in an era full of information, people just need to take the time to look for the stories. Over the years I have followed the post Apple career of Steve “Woz” Wozniak. I've read quite a bit about Paul Allen recently, a very interesting man. Both Allen and Wozniak have done quite a bit since leaving the companies they helped create.
